Twice Baked Potatoes
Twice Baked Potatoes is an moderately easy dinner. Made with 4 small baking potatoes (4 to 5 oz. each), 2 oz. fat-free cream cheese, cubed and softened, 2 tbsp. snipped chives, 1/4 tsp. dried basil, crushed and 1/2 c. skim milk, this recipe delivers authentic, satisfying flavors. Pierce potatoes with a fork.
Bake at 375° for 45 to 50 minutes or until tender.
Cool slightly.
Cut potatoes in half lengthwise. Gently scoop out each potato half, leaving a thin shell.
Set shells aside.
Place pulp into a smaller mixer bowl.
Add cream cheese, chives, basil, salt and pepper; beat until smooth.
Add milk, beating until potato mixture is fluffy.
Spoon potato mixture into shells.
Sprinkle with paprika.
Place on baking sheet.
Cover loosely with foil.
Bake at 375° for 10 minutes.
